Canon EOS M3: problem with bouncing built-in flash

Recently I have upgraded from M10 to M3.

With my M10 I could bend the built-in flash all the way back, but not with the M3:

when I bend the flash halfway or so, it works OK, but when I bend it all the way back, at some point the flash icon changes from "Flash On" to "Flash Off" and the the flash would not fire in this position, no matter what (current mode, settings, etc./ see pictures below).

After a very extended search I have found only one or two (rather confidential) reviews mentioning this issue.

All the others reviewers "can" bounce the built-in flash without any problem... Or do they only pretend to?

So here is my question please: is it one of the numerous quirks of the M3 or is it only my particular camera?
